> How are things going with the port of CUWiN to Linux?  
> John Kintree

We have a working crossbuild to Linux (though it may need to be upgraded 
again given recent software improvements).  Porting the software 
outright to Linux is like trying to do needlepoint on a roller-coaster 
-- because the software is still under heavy development, the port would 
need to be constantly upgraded (and thus would require dedicated staff 
to maintain).  Once the software stabilizes (for example, once version 
1.0 is released), it may make sense to do this -- especially if there's 
interest for specific applications.  Mostly, we either need more 
volunteers or the funding to support more dedicated staff to undertake 
something like that.
